Red Badge Group is seeking a dedicated and experienced individual to join our team as a Security Site Supervisor for Centre Place, one of Hamilton's busiest retail spaces. This vital role supports the delivery of safe, welcoming, and memorable environments in a large retail space. As a Security Site Supervisor, you will lead by example, ensuring operational excellence, team engagement, and outstanding service delivery. If you are passionate about people leadership, security management, and providing exceptional customer experiences, we encourage you to apply and continue your career with Red Badge Group. This role is on a Monday - Friday roster working during normal business hours. Key Responsibilities Lead and supervise on‑site security staff, providing clear direction and role‑modeling professional standards. Manage day‑to‑day security operations, ensuring full site coverage and compliance with Centre Place SOPs. Act as the primary on‑site escalation point for all security, medical, fire, and behavioural incidents. Coordinate emergency responses in line with the site Emergency Response Procedures. Oversee CCTV, access control, alarms, and key systems, ensuring privacy and data compliance. Maintain accurate, timely incident reporting Build and maintain strong working relationships with Centre Management, tenants, and external stakeholders. Manage staff attendance, shift handovers, and operational priorities to prevent service gaps. Support induction, training, coaching, and ongoing performance development of security staff. Ensure health and safety, risk management, and Red Badge Group values are upheld at all times. Required Skills and Experience 1–3 years’ experience in a people leadership or supervisory role, ideally within security, retail, facilities, events, hospitality, or a related environment. Current NZ COA licence, or equivalent leadership experience within the security sector. Proven ability to manage day‑to‑day operations in small to medium client environments.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build effective relationships across diverse groups. Sound knowledge of security best practice, compliance, health and safety, and risk management. Confidence in incident reporting, documentation, and use of security systems. Clean criminal conviction record and physical capability to meet operational demands. Eligibility to work in New Zealand and aged 18 years or over.
